Victor Murray of Plano Texas passed away on February 12, 2025 after a short battle with stage 4 Cholangiocarcinoma. at the age of 65. He was born on June 27, 1959 in Anaheim California and spent his early childhood living near DisneyLand watching fireworks at night from his backyard. When he was in middle school he moved to Springfield, Missouri with his mom and dad and sister Lori and his dad opened Lakeshor Barber Shop that he operated for over 50 years. When Vic wasn't helping his dad in the barber shop on weekends he was riding his bike or skateboard selling grit newspapers at the Hospital and thinking of his first car. Vic actually had three Corvairs when he turned 16 that he liked to restore and sell. His love for cars would continue the rest of his life.
Vic graduated from Parkview High School and went to Missouri State University on a music scholarship for playing trumpet. He wanted to graduate and play in the band at Disneyland but one of his college professors suggested that he study Management Information Systems and Marketing instead and that led to his lifelong career in software sales.
Right out of college Vic and a Pi Kappa Alpha fraternity brother packed up their cars and drove to Dallas. He got a job at TI and that lasted about a week because it was a desk job and if you know Vic you know sitting around wasn’t for him. Over the years he worked at HP, Oracle, Broadcom, McAfee, Cyren and Tanium. He made many lifelong friends throughout his career and won over 20 sales club trips for top performers- travelling often to Maui.
Vic had many hobbies throughout his life including buying and selling cars, skiing, golfing, playing the guitar and learning to fly in his 40’s. He had a few airplanes but his Bonanza was his favorite. In 2011 he met his wife Pam. When they met they talked about having 30 Christmases together and living life intentionally. They did not have that many but ”Team VLA” made the most out of their lives together travelling, owning a home in Florida, golfing, entertaining in their home, enjoying the company of many friends and spending time with their children. Vic was very proud of his kids and we often talked and dreamed of the bright future in front of all of them. He loved them dearly.
He is preceded in death by his parents Norma and Bill Murray as well as his sister Lori Murray.
Vic is survived by Blake and Ashton Murray Kelsey and Andrey Ziegler Kaitlyn Blankenship and his beloved “Lala”, Pam Murray.
